Benefit planned for Walls

'Jump Start June's Heart' is the theme for a communitywide effort to help Walls get a needed heart transplant.

Wednesday, March 16, 2011

— Jump Start June’s Heart, a benefit chili supper and auction to help June Walls with medical expenses, will be held at the Decatur Northside Elementary School on April 9.

June is in need of a heart transplant after suffering from several heart attacks and related complications over the past year. She is currently on a transplant list at St. Judes Hospital in Kansas City, according to Kayla Ellison, who is helping organize the benefit.

The entire Walls family is in need of community support, Ellison said. June’s mother, Bernice, has recently been faced with serious medical problems as well, she said.

June has been a big part of the Decatur community for many years. She attended Decatur Schools from kindergarten until she graduated in 1992, where she participated in many extra curricular activities including basketball and cheer leading.

June was very involved in pageants and modeled for Seventeen and Glamour magazine. She held several titles, including Miss Decatur Barbecue, and has continued as the director of the Decatur Barbecue Pageant for the past eight years.

June has worked for Decatur Schools for more than 10 years in both the elementary and middle school, where she taught elementary art, was a seventh grade basketball coach, a cheer leading coach and kept the basketball books for 10 years. June has also worked at the swimming pools in both Decatur and Gravette for several years.

The chili supper will begin at 4 p.m., April 9, at the Decatur Northside Elementary School cafeteria. Dwayne Craig and Rob Hopkins will serve as auctioneers for the benefit auction which will begin at 7 p.m.

Benefit organizers are welcoming donations of desserts or new items for the auction.

“We’d like to invite everyone to come. If they can’t come, maybe they can just donate,” Ellison said.
